Hint: Report writing is a formal style of writing that focuses on a specific topic in depth. A report's tone is always formal. The intended audience is always considered in this section. For instance, writing a report about a school event, writing a report about a business case, and so on.

REPORT ON EARTHQUAKE OF NEPAL
Earthquakes, one of the most severe natural disasters, is being felt by people all over the world. Nepal is a seismically vulnerable country with a high risk of earthquakes. Every forty years, Nepal can expect two earthquakes with a magnitude of 7.5-8 on the Richter scale and one earthquakes with a magnitude of 8+ on the Richter scale every eighty years.

According to studies, Nepal has 92 fault lines that can cause an earthquake. Nepal is also ranked 11th in the list of most dangerous countries for earthquakes, as well as first in the list of cities with the highest human casualties. Note: One should keep the following in mind while attempting report writing:
- In the end, write your executive summary and table of contents.
- Concentrate on the goal. Make sure you know what your report's purpose is and who you're writing it for.
- Before you begin writing, make a plan. Collect all of your research and pertinent data.
- Make sentences as brief and straightforward as possible. Each sentence should only include one primary concept.
